| Model | Capacity (m³) | Heating Area (m²) | Motor Power (kW) | Inner Tank Thickness (mm) | Coil Thickness (mm) |
|---|---|---|---|---|---|
| WACR-500 | 0.5 | 1.2 | 1.5 | 5 | 3 |
| WACR-1000 | 1 | 2.0 | 2.2 | 6 | 3 |
| WACR-2000 | 2 | 3.5 | 4 | 8 | 4 |
| WACR-3000 | 3 | 4.8 | 5.5 | 8 | 4 |
| WACR-5000 | 5 | 7.2 | 7.5 | 10 | 5 |
| WACR-10000 | 10 | 12.5 | 11 | 12 | 6 |
Heating or cooling coil configuration can be customized according to process requirements.

The coil-type reactor is designed to provide efficient temperature control for industrial chemical reactions. The reactor incorporates internal or external coil structures that allow heating or cooling media to circulate, ensuring uniform heat transfer throughout the reaction vessel.
This design improves thermal efficiency and enables precise temperature management during chemical processing. Constructed from high-quality stainless steel, the reactor offers excellent corrosion resistance and structural strength for long-term industrial operation.
Coil-type reactors are widely used in chemical production, polymer processing, resin manufacturing, pharmaceutical synthesis, and other temperature-sensitive reaction processes.
